rawDLC For Your Ears Only: First-Person Shooter fundamentals

What makes a shooter impossible to put down? What is the “x” factor that turns average everyday Joes and Joesephines into unstoppable pixel killing machines? rawDLC and guest Mark Serrels explore the defining characteristics of today’s most addictive shooters.
